#define THIS_LAYOUT_WIDTH (740.0)
#define INFORMATION_TXT_HEIGHT (32.0 / THIS_LAYOUT_HEIGHT)
-#define DIGIT_ENTRY_HEIGHT (68.0 / THIS_LAYOUT_HEIGHT)
+#define DIGIT_ENTRY_HEIGHT (58.0 / THIS_LAYOUT_HEIGHT)
#define DIGIT_ENTRY_WIDTH (68.0 / THIS_LAYOUT_WIDTH)
-#define DIGIT_ENTRY_SPACING_X (2.0 / THIS_LAYOUT_WIDTH)
+#define DIGIT_ENTRY_SPACING_X (20.0 / THIS_LAYOUT_WIDTH)
#define DIGIT_ENTRY_SPACING_Y (2.0 / THIS_LAYOUT_HEIGHT)
-#define PIN_DIGIT_Y1 (((32.0 + 154.0 / 2.0) / THIS_LAYOUT_HEIGHT) - DIGIT_ENTRY_HEIGHT / 2.0)
+#define PIN_DIGIT_Y1 ((((32.0 + 154.0 / 2.0) / THIS_LAYOUT_HEIGHT) - DIGIT_ENTRY_HEIGHT / 2.0 + 0.1) + 0.08)
#define PIN_DIGIT_Y2 (PIN_DIGIT_Y1 + DIGIT_ENTRY_HEIGHT)
+#define WARN_Y (PIN_DIGIT_Y2 + 0.3)
#define PIN_DIGIT_1_X1 (0.5 - 2.0 * (DIGIT_ENTRY_WIDTH) - 3 * DIGIT_ENTRY_SPACING_X)
#define PIN_DIGIT_1_X2 (0.5 - DIGIT_ENTRY_WIDTH - 3 * DIGIT_ENTRY_SPACING_X)
#define PIN_DIGIT_2_X1 (0.5 - DIGIT_ENTRY_WIDTH - DIGIT_ENTRY_SPACING_X)
{
state: "default" 0.0;
color: 104 104 104 255;
- rel1.relative: 0.0 0.0;
+ rel1.relative: 0.0 0.15;
rel2.relative: 1.0 INFORMATION_TXT_HEIGHT;
text
{
}
}
}
-
part
{
type: RECT;
description
{
state: "default" 0.0;
- color: 0 0 0 255;
+ color: 188 188 188 255;
+ visible: 0;
rel1.relative: (PIN_DIGIT_1_X1 - DIGIT_ENTRY_SPACING_X) (PIN_DIGIT_Y1 - DIGIT_ENTRY_SPACING_Y);
rel2.relative: (PIN_DIGIT_4_X2 + DIGIT_ENTRY_SPACING_X) (PIN_DIGIT_Y2 + DIGIT_ENTRY_SPACING_Y);
}
description
{
state: "default" 0.0;
+ min: 78.0 78.0;
+ color: 188 188 188 255;
+ rel1.to: PART_ENTRY_1;
+ rel2.to: PART_ENTRY_1;
+ rel1.relative: 0.0 0.0;
+ rel2.relative: 1.0 1.0;
+ }
+ }
+ part
+ {
+ type: RECT;
+ scale: 1;
+ description
+ {
+ state: "default" 0.0;
+ min: 68.0 68.0;
color: 255 255 255 255;
rel1.to: PART_ENTRY_1;
rel2.to: PART_ENTRY_1;
description
{
state: "default" 0.0;
+ min: 78.0 78.0;
+ color: 188 188 188 255;
+ rel1.to: PART_ENTRY_2;
+ rel2.to: PART_ENTRY_2;
+ rel1.relative: 0.0 0.0;
+ rel2.relative: 1.0 1.0;
+ }
+ }
+ part
+ {
+ type: RECT;
+ scale: 1;
+ description
+ {
+ state: "default" 0.0;
+ min: 68.0 68.0;
color: 255 255 255 255;
rel1.to: PART_ENTRY_2;
rel2.to: PART_ENTRY_2;
description
{
state: "default" 0.0;
+ min: 78.0 78.0;
+ color: 188 188 188 255;
+ rel1.to: PART_ENTRY_3;
+ rel2.to: PART_ENTRY_3;
+ rel1.relative: 0.0 0.0;
+ rel2.relative: 1.0 1.0;
+ }
+ }
+ part
+ {
+ type: RECT;
+ scale: 1;
+ description
+ {
+ state: "default" 0.0;
+ min: 68.0 68.0;
color: 255 255 255 255;
rel1.to: PART_ENTRY_3;
rel2.to: PART_ENTRY_3;
description
{
state: "default" 0.0;
+ min: 78.0 78.0;
+ color: 188 188 188 255;
+ rel1.to: PART_ENTRY_4;
+ rel2.to: PART_ENTRY_4;
+ rel1.relative: 0.0 0.0;
+ rel2.relative: 1.0 1.0;
+ }
+ }
+ part
+ {
+ type: RECT;
+ scale: 1;
+ description
+ {
+ state: "default" 0.0;
+ min: 68.0 68.0;
color: 255 255 255 255;
rel1.to: PART_ENTRY_4;
rel2.to: PART_ENTRY_4;
rel2.relative: PIN_DIGIT_4_X2 PIN_DIGIT_Y2;
}
}
-
part
{
name: "warn";
{
state: "default" 0.0;
color: 255 0 0 255;
- rel1.relative: 0.0 PIN_DIGIT_Y2;
+ rel1.relative: 0.0 WARN_Y;
rel2.relative: 1.0 1.0;
text
{